    Lower stock 2008

    I think someone was blowing smoke up your butt when they told you your oem struts failed from a stiffer spring rate. Springs absorb the energy of a bump or pothole,Shocks work to dampen the springs natural tendancy to oscillate. In simple terms when you hit a pothole with factory rate...

    WTB Rear LCA's

    For lower control arms, no. Adjustable control arms would be used if you wanted to extend your wheelbase to fit a big sticky tire for drag racing, or to fine tune thrust angle. If you lower it, it's a good idea to use a relocation bracket to bring the angle of the control arm back to where...

    adjustable sway bar end links

    Sway bar level with ground at ride height is a good place to start. A front bar is usually not preloaded at all. The second bolt should slide right in. If you want to get really accurate, do that with driver in car. On occasion we preload rear anti-roll bars for drag race launch purposes but...
